Schrödinger’s Cats
https://www.kickstarter.com/projects/594145763/schrodingers-cats?ref=nav_search
Uncertainty didn’t kill the cat, but that doesn’t mean it’s not dead. Dr. Erwin Schrödinger and Werner Heisenberg taught us that. We’ve all heard about the cats in boxes experiment and maybe we’re even curious about the results — but trying such an experiment would be INSANE in real life! Now you can try your hand at challenging the uncertainty principle without risking the lives innocent kittens or exposure to radioactive particles! Awww!
In Schrödinger’s Cats players run experiments, form hypotheses, and try to one-up each other’s research. Players take on the role of a Cat Physicist such as Albert Felinestein, Sally Prride or Neil deGrasse Tabby! Using their special ability to help prove their hypothesis or at least debunk someone else’s, each cat physicist tries to determine the minimum number of alive cats, dead cats, or empty boxes across all the boxes in Schrödinger’s lab.

Now That 2014 is Behind Us
I think that it’s important that we reintroduce 9th Level Games to you. 9th Level Games is not a “big company.” It’s really just 2 dudes – Chris O’Neill and Dan Landis. When we are talking about Kobolds Ate My Baby! we are joined by our friend, John Kovalic. That being said, 9LG has never been a full time (or even really a part time) gig – but it is passion project that we all love, and are grateful for what it has produced and will continue to produce.
When we started the KOBOLDS ATE MY BABY! IN COLOUR!!! Kickstarter, the goal was simple - fund a new edition of the game, to get the game back in print after an absence of a few years. We never thought that we would get the support that we did, both in the form of backers, players and help on the books (from fan editors, etc.)
During the campaign, we got really caught up in it – and our expectations of how much work we could get done (from Chris, Dan and John) in a timely fashion was … well, it was incorrect.
KAMB! IC!!! took way longer than we expected. Our very aggressive goals were set because we just though we were going to just “redo” the game. What came out of the Kickstarter was something more – and we decided to really invest the time and effort to make it something special. The amount of work that we put into getting KAMB complete wasn't sustainable, which is one of the reasons that it has taken us this long to get to More Things to Kill and Eat.
Unlike a lot of groups, we don’t hire people to do the work – we do everything, from design and playtest, to writing, to art, to layout, to shipping, to packing, to conventions, to whatever. In hindsight, we could have looked to expand the team to meet the demands of this KS.
2014 turned out to be a great and scary year for all of us. Dan became a dad. Chris has a seriously crazy year in the “real world” of work. John continued to be more and more in demand as Munchkin and other Steve Jackson Games worked exploded. Our commitments for conventions were “ambitious” to say the least. In order to make 2015 work, we clearly had to make some changes.

Even More Things to Kill and Eat
So, you may have heard that John Kovalic is a busy, busy, busy guy! Unfortunately for us, John has other commitments that trump KAMB (even if he loves working on Kobolds). A big part of the modern KAMB game is John’s art, and Dan and I look at John as a partner in this venture – so we can’t just go out and hire another artist (nor would we, John’s interpretation of our characters is a huge part of what makes KAMB special). Due to John Kovalic’s other commitments, we have been held up on the art for the new book (and its a ton of all new, all color art).
9th Level needs to work with John when he can find and make time to draw the Kobolds.
That being said, we have slipped deadlines on art for the book multiple times, and are now looking at getting the full art around the Middle of February 2015, which if all goes well, would result in us getting DIGITAL PDF copies to backers in MARCH (with printed copies out by the summer, hopefully before convention season). We will be very upfront around timing and delivery of this to you all.
We aren’t going to rush things, but everything but final layout and art is complete, so we are hoping for a fast turnaround once we get the new art. Early sketches and designs are really great…
Along with MORE THINGS, the second set of PRINT AND SLAY PAPER MINIS will be available (and based on the art that we have seen so far) will be great. When we have the book off to the printers, we will be getting this product out to everyone as well (and creating a set of multiple “hard cardboard” print on demand versions). These Print and Slays will be about 4 weeks behind the MORE THINGS PDF.
